How long does it take to bleed air from the coolant system?

Bleeding air from a coolant system is a crucial step in maintaining your vehicle’s performance and preventing overheating. Generally, the process can take anywhere from 20 minutes to an hour, depending on the vehicle type and system complexity. Correctly performing this task ensures that your engine runs smoothly and efficiently.

How to Bleed Air from a Coolant System?

Bleeding air from a coolant system involves removing trapped air pockets that can cause overheating and inefficient cooling. Here’s a step-by-step guide to help you through the process:

  1. Prepare Your Vehicle

    • Ensure the engine is cool before starting.
    • Park on a level surface and engage the parking brake.
  2. Open the Radiator Cap

    • Slowly remove the radiator cap to release any built-up pressure.
  3. Locate the Bleeder Valve

    • Consult your vehicle’s manual to find the bleeder valve, usually located near the thermostat housing or radiator.
  4. Fill the Coolant Reservoir

    • Add coolant to the reservoir until it reaches the recommended level.
  5. Start the Engine

    • Turn on the engine and let it idle. This helps circulate the coolant and push out air bubbles.
  6. Open the Bleeder Valve

    • Carefully open the bleeder valve to allow trapped air to escape. You might see bubbles or hear a hissing sound.
  7. Monitor Coolant Levels

    • Keep an eye on the coolant level and top up as needed.
  8. Close the Bleeder Valve

    • Once the air is expelled, close the valve securely.
  9. Check for Leaks

    • Inspect the system for any leaks to ensure everything is sealed properly.
  10. Test Drive

    • Take a short drive to confirm the system is functioning correctly without overheating.

Why is Bleeding Air Important?

Bleeding air from the coolant system is vital for several reasons:

  • Prevents Overheating: Air pockets can disrupt the flow of coolant, leading to engine overheating.
  • Enhances Efficiency: A properly bled system ensures optimal coolant circulation, improving engine performance.
  • Prevents Corrosion: Removing air reduces the risk of rust and corrosion within the system.

Common Mistakes to Avoid

When bleeding your coolant system, it’s important to avoid common pitfalls:

  • Skipping the Cool Down: Never attempt to bleed the system while the engine is hot.
  • Ignoring Leaks: Ensure all connections are tight to prevent coolant leaks.
  • Inadequate Coolant Levels: Always maintain the correct coolant level to avoid introducing new air pockets.

How Often Should You Bleed Your Coolant System?

Regular maintenance of your coolant system can prevent many issues. It’s generally recommended to bleed the system:

  • After Replacing Coolant: Whenever you drain and refill the coolant, bleed the system.
  • Following Repairs: If any cooling system components are replaced, air bleeding is necessary.
  • Routine Maintenance: Periodic checks can prevent unexpected problems.

How do I know if there is air in my coolant system?

Signs of air in the coolant system include engine overheating, inconsistent temperature gauge readings, and gurgling noises from the radiator or heater core.

Can I drive with air in the coolant system?

Driving with air in the coolant system is not recommended, as it can lead to overheating and potential engine damage. It’s best to address the issue promptly.

What happens if you don’t bleed the cooling system?

Failing to bleed the cooling system can cause overheating, inefficient cooling, and increased wear on engine components. This can lead to costly repairs if not addressed.

Is bleeding the coolant system the same for all vehicles?

While the basic process is similar, specific steps may vary based on the vehicle make and model. Always consult your vehicle’s manual for detailed instructions.

Can I use water instead of coolant to bleed the system?

Using water instead of coolant is not advisable, as it lacks the necessary properties to protect against freezing and corrosion. Always use the recommended coolant for your vehicle.
